1. Understanding the Balance Between Skill and Chance in Games
a. Defining Skill-Based Elements in Gaming
Skill in games can be broadly defined as the player’s ability to influence the outcome through knowledge, strategy, or dexterity. This contrasts with games where outcomes are predominantly determined by external factors. In skill-based games, success often depends on decision-making, timing, pattern recognition or mastering specific mechanics. For example, chess or poker require a deep understanding of tactics, whereas platform video games test reflexes and precision.
b. The Role of Chance and Randomness
Chance introduces unpredictability and randomness, creating uncertainty about outcomes. In gambling, this is often represented by dice rolls, shuffled cards or spinning reels. Pure chance games depend solely on luck, with players having no influence beyond placing bets. Randomness enhances excitement and fairness but can also lead to frustration when outcomes feel wholly beyond control.
c. Why Blending Skill and Chance Appeals to Players
Combining skill and chance allows games to engage a broader audience by offering both accessibility and depth. Chance elements maintain suspense and surprise, while skill elements provide a sense of mastery and control. Players often feel more motivated to improve and continue playing when they believe their decisions impact the outcome. This blend also supports varied player styles, from casual participants to competitive strategists.
2. Historical Evolution of Chance and Skill in Gambling
a. Traditional Games of Pure Chance
Historically, many gambling games were based entirely on chance. Roulette, lotteries and slot machines are classic examples where players rely on luck alone. These games have roots stretching back centuries and were often designed for simplicity and quick resolution, facilitating social gambling in taverns or fairs.
b. Early Skill-Based Games and Their Impact
Skill-based games such as poker and blackjack introduced strategic elements to gambling. Players could improve their odds through card counting, bluffing or probability calculations. These games gained immense popularity partly because they offered a perception of fairness and intellectual challenge, distinguishing them from pure chance games.
c. The Transition to Hybrid Models
The fusion of skill and chance emerged as technology advanced and player preferences evolved. Hybrid games began incorporating decision points, bonus rounds requiring timing or pattern recognition, and interactive features that rewarded player input. This transition reflects a broader trend towards more engaging and immersive gambling experiences.
3. The Mechanics Behind Modern Video Slots
a. How Video Slots Incorporate Random Number Generators (RNG)
Modern video slots rely on Random Number Generators (RNGs) to ensure fair and unpredictable outcomes. The RNG continuously cycles through numbers, which determine the position of symbols on reels at the moment a player spins. This technology guarantees that each spin is independent and random, preventing predictable patterns.
b. Introduction of Skill-Based Features in Slots
While traditional slots are purely chance-based, many modern video slots incorporate skill elements in bonus rounds or interactive mini-games. Players may be required to time button presses, solve puzzles or make strategic choices that influence rewards. These features enhance engagement and give players a feeling of agency without undermining the core randomness.
c. Symbol Functions: Wilds, Scatters and Their Influence on Outcomes
Symbols such as wilds and scatters play a pivotal role in video slots’ dynamics. Wilds substitute for other symbols to complete winning combinations, while scatters often trigger bonus features or free spins. Although their appearance is random, understanding their function allows players to better interpret the game and anticipate potential outcomes.
4. Case Study: Video Slots as a Paradigm of Skill-Chance Fusion
a. The Origins and Development of Video Slots Since 1976
Video slots first emerged in 1976 with the introduction of the Fortune Coin machine by Bally Technologies. Unlike mechanical slots, these used video screens to display reels, allowing for more complex features and graphics. Over the decades, video slots have evolved to include immersive themes, multi-paylines, and interactive bonus rounds, often blending chance with skill-based challenges.
b. Examples of Skill Elements in Contemporary Video Slots
Many modern video slots incorporate skill in various ways:
- Timed bonus rounds, where players must stop reels or select objects at the right moment.
- Decision-making stages influencing multipliers or jackpot eligibility.
- Mini-games requiring pattern recognition or memory skills to unlock prizes.
These features add depth and encourage repeat play by rewarding player interaction.

5. Psychological and Behavioural Effects of Combining Skill and Chance
a. Player Perception of Control and Fairness
When skill elements are present, players often perceive higher control over outcomes, which enhances feelings of fairness. This perception can reduce frustration and increase satisfaction, even when actual returns are governed by chance. The illusion of control, when balanced appropriately, is a powerful motivator in engagement.
b. Engagement and Retention Through Mixed Mechanics
Hybrid games that blend chance and skill tend to sustain player interest longer than purely chance-based games. The skill component introduces variability and a learning curve, encouraging players to return and hone their strategies. This dynamic also supports social interaction and competition, further boosting retention.
c. Risk Management and Decision-Making in Hybrid Games
Integrating skill requires players to assess risks and make decisions that influence their potential gains or losses. This engages cognitive processes related to probability evaluation, impulse control and reward anticipation. Such active participation can lead to more responsible gambling habits, as players become more aware of their choices.
6. Technological Innovations Driving the Skill-Chance Blend
a. The Impact of Blockchain and Cryptocurrency on Game Design
Blockchain technology has introduced transparency and security to gambling, enabling provably fair games where outcomes can be independently verified. This openness supports player trust and allows developers to experiment with novel game mechanics that integrate digital assets and smart contracts, thus expanding both skill and chance dimensions.
b. Use of Artificial Intelligence to Adapt Difficulty and Skill Elements
Artificial Intelligence (AI) enables games to dynamically adjust difficulty levels and tailor skill challenges to individual players’ abilities. This personalised approach maintains engagement by avoiding frustration or boredom, fostering a balanced experience where skill can progressively influence outcomes without compromising randomness.
c. Future Trends in Interactive and Skill-Based Gambling
Looking ahead, immersive technologies such as virtual and augmented reality promise to deepen skill integration by creating rich, interactive environments. Combined with AI and blockchain, future gambling products are likely to offer increasingly sophisticated blends of chance and skill, appealing to a wider spectrum of players and raising new regulatory questions.
7. Regulatory and Ethical Considerations
a. How Regulators View Skill Versus Chance in Gaming Classification
Regulators often differentiate games by their reliance on chance or skill, as this influences legal classification and licensing requirements. Pure chance games typically fall under gambling regulations, while skill-based games may be considered competitions or entertainment. The rise of hybrid models complicates this distinction, requiring clearer frameworks to ensure compliance and consumer protection.
